Building a National Biodiversity Market

We support the Australian Government’s plans to establish a biodiversity market to promote investment in and drive better outcomes for biodiversity across the country. We have provided input to the consultation calling for the development of credible and robust criteria and mechanisms that will ensure meaningful and verifiable improvements to Australia’s biodiversity.

National Construction Code (NCC) 2022

Following the adoption of improved energy performance standards for new homes in NCC 2022, GBCA is continuing to work with our industry partners to advocate for a coordinated and timely approach to implementation of the new requirements across all Australian jurisdictions.
We are now sharpening our focus on consultation for NCC 2025 to ensure the positive momentum towards zero carbon buildings continues.
